Image file storage destinations and file names

The image files recorded with the camera are grouped
as folders on the internal memory or the "Memory Stick
Duo".

Notes
• You cannot record any images to the "100MSDCF" folder. The images in this folder are available only
for viewing. This folder is displayed only when "Memory Stick Duo" is inserted into the camera.
• You cannot record/play back any images to the "MISC" folder.
• Image files are named as follows:
– Still image files: DSC0ssss.JPG
– Movie files: MOV0ssss.MPG
– Index image files that are recorded when you record movies: MOV0ssss.THM
ssss stands for any number within the range from 0001 to 9999. The numerical portions of the name
of a movie file recorded in movie mode and its corresponding index image file are the same.
• For more information about folders, see pages 54 and 101.
• When folders are moved, it may no longer be possible to view their images on the camera.
